Seeking admission for children is a huge task in itself. Parents not only tell about the schools and their brand value but also about the syllabus that will work best for their children. A few years ago, they chose state syllabus if they did not think they were going to move cities and national syllabus if they were in a transferable job.

For the remaining parents for whom this option is not easy by the nature of their jobs, there is a difficult time between the two national courses – CBSE or Central Board of Secondary Education and ICSE or Indian Certificate of Secondary Education.

CBSE & ICSE

Testing students: While these were the basic differences between the two boards, there is also a difference in how they test students. CBSE exams are more application-based, while the ICSE exam tests true knowledge, understanding and application.

Difficult course in ICSE: The syllabus for CBSE is considered intensive while ICSE is more comprehensive. The CBSE system of teaching has more objective type questions that help students prepare themselves for the national level competitive examinations. On the other hand, projects are an integral part of the curriculum under the ICSE board, which helps build a student's analytical skills.

National level exams based on CBSE: Competitive entrance exams like IIT-JEE, NEET (AIPMT) and JEE Main are based on CBSE syllabus, which is another reason for parents to prioritize CBSE over ICSE. Anybody wants to write to children of these exams.

Emphasis on English in ICSE: Teachers feel that there is a clear emphasis on English and its literature in ICSE syllabus. The way of English grammar is taught under the ICSE syllabus is very systematic. On the other hand, in CBSE school in mp(http://gyanganga.ac.in), English is taught in a more functional way and it caters to the needs of all types of students irrespective of their geographical location.

Easy to shift from ICSE to CBSE: While ICSE students find it comparatively easier to shift to CBSE at higher levels, the vice-versa is not as easy for the students as the ICSE syllabus is quite heavy.
ICSE students recently completed their 6th-grade exam, they completed 13 subjects - English, History Civics, Environmental Science, Geography, Mathematics, Hindi, Physics, Biology, Chemistry, Kannada and General Knowledge took the final exam. On the other hand, a CBSE student of Kendriya Vidyalaya who completed his 7th-grade exam wrote a total of six papers - English, Hindi, Sanskrit, Science, Social Studies and Mathematics.
